2 阿窗

尚未进行身份认证

我要认证

暂无相关简介

等级
TA的排名 28w+

html + css 页面向导

效果:html:<div class="guide"> <div class="guide-item over"> <span>1</span> <p>身份认证</p> </div> <!-- /.guide-item --> <div class="guide-item on"> <span>2

2020-07-09 11:43:38

移动端input number maxlength 无效解决办法

<input type="number" oninput="if(value.length > 6) value = value.slice(0,6)" />

2020-07-06 17:54:55

从输入url到页面返回的全过程

从输入url到页面返回的全过程。1.我们输入一个域名:www.baidu.com,然后点击确认;2.浏览器查找域名的IP地址。查找过程如下:首先是浏览器缓存,浏览器会缓存DNS记录一段时间;如果在浏览器缓存里没有找到需要的记录,浏览器会做一个系统调用,获取系统缓存中的记录;然后是路由器缓存,路由器一般会有自己的缓存;如果前者都没有找到,就需要从本地域名服务器开始进行DNS查询了。详细的DNS查询过程我在DNS工作原理及过程中讲到过。3.现在浏览...

2020-07-02 12:59:35

js16进制转10进制

var ex16hex = function (value) { value = value.replace(/^\s+|\s+$/g, ""); var ex10 = document.getElementById('ex10'); if (value) { value = stripscript(value); value = value.replace("0x", ""); var arr = value.split("");.

2020-07-02 11:21:53

js正则去掉字符串空格

//str为要去除空格的字符串://去除所有空格:str = str.replace(/\s+/g,"");//去除两头空格:str = str.replace(/^\s+|\s+$/g,"");//去除左空格:str=str.replace( /^\s*/, '');//去除右空格:str=str.replace(/(\s*$)/g, "");

2020-07-02 10:53:44

微信小程序 picker date 时间 start 和 end 无效

<picker mode="date" value="{{date}}" start="{{start}}" end="{{end}}" bindchange="bindDateChange"> <view class="picker"> {{date}} {{week}} </view></picker>直接这样设置就可以了,开发者工具暂时不支持这两个属性,在真机上是有效的...

2020-06-29 19:49:00

微信小程序 radio checked=false

这属于微信小程序的bug,官方文档给的是这样的然而实际运用中,我的代码是这样<radio-group bindchange="radioChange"> <label> <radio value="0" checked="true"/> <text>预订单</text> </label> <label style="margin-left: 20rpx">

2020-06-29 19:24:42

js递归处理文字溢出缩小字体

需求是,在特定的高度盒子里,文字溢出隐藏的效果不理想,就想看全部,没得说,改呗var fontSize = function(item, size = 16) { var bh = item.outerHeight();//box高 var th = item.children().outerHeight();//文字高 if(bh - th < 0 && size > 12){ item.find('.js_textContent

2020-06-22 20:43:48

git版本回滚

Git回滚代码到某个commit回退命令:git reset --hard HEAD^ 回退到上个版本git reset --hard HEAD~3 回退到前3次提交之前,以此类推,回退到n次提交之前git reset --hard commit_id 退到/进到,指定commit的哈希码(这次提交之前或之后的提交都会回滚)回滚后提交可能会失败,必须强制提交强推到远程:(可能需要解决对应分支的保护状态)git push origin HEAD --force————————————

2020-06-19 15:22:29

微信小程序开发---自定义动态tabBar

最近开发微信小程序,公司要求做一个类似闲鱼的tabbar,但是网上大多资料的tabbar都会在页面切换的时候重新渲染,所以我写了一个不会重新渲染的tabbar,有需要的直接拿走不谢。https://github.com/SuRuiGit/wxapp-customTabbar使用步骤如下:第一步:找到项目中的tabbarComponent目录,拷贝到你的工程中,然后将tabbarComponent->icon图标替换成你自己的tabbar图片第二步:到app.json中配置tabBar,这里我

2020-06-19 14:23:24

微信小程序报错: thirdScriptError

微信小程序报错VM1305:1 thirdScriptErrorCannot read property 'name' of undefinedTypeError: Cannot read property 'name' of undefined at z (http://127.0.0.1:38175/appservice/__dev__/WAService.js:2:1560728) at Ie (http://127.0.0.1:38175/appservice/__dev_

2020-06-19 13:54:41

js随机生成指定位数的字母数字组合字符串,可选择字母大小写

var a = "";var string = function(len){ len = len || 32; var $chars = 'ABCDEFGHJKMNPQRSTWXYZabcdefhijkmnprstwxyz2345678'; // 默认去掉了容易混淆的字符oOLl,9gq,Vv,Uu,I1 var maxPos = $chars.length; var pwd = ''; var num = ''; for (i = 0; i < .

2020-06-17 09:18:36

js 只能输入小数点跟数字

$(document).on('keyup','.numDecText',function(){ $(this).val($(this).val().replace(/[^0-9.]/g,''));}).bind("paste",function(){ //CTR+V事件处理 $(this).val($(this).val().replace(/[^0-9.]/g,''));}).css("ime-mode", "disabled"); //CSS设置输入法不可用...

2020-06-16 17:48:23

css 修改input提示文字颜色

input:-moz-placeholder,textarea:-moz-placeholder { color: #fff;}input:-ms-input-placeholder,textarea:-ms-input-placeholder { color: #fff;}input::-webkit-input-placeholder,textarea::-webkit-input-placeholder { color: #fff ;}

2020-06-16 17:47:25

css loading效果

html :<div class="bouncing-loader"> <div></div> <div></div> <div></div></div>css:@keyframes bouncing-loader { to { opacity: 0.1; transform: translate3d(0, -1rem, 0); }}.bouncing-l

2020-06-16 17:46:49

js 浏览器语音播报

var utterThis = new window.SpeechSynthesisUtterance('支付宝到账,323324234');window.speechSynthesis.speak(utterThis);

2020-06-16 17:45:51

js操作浏览器cookie

//JS操作cookies方法!//写cookiesfunction setCookie(name,value){ var Days = 30; var exp = new Date(); exp.setTime(exp.getTime() + Days*24*60*60*1000); document.cookie = name + "="+ escape (value) + ";expires=" + exp.toGMTString();}//读取cooki.

2020-06-16 17:45:20

js 百度地图第一次初始化标的位置不对,解决方案

// 百度地图API功能var map = new BMap.Map("map");var point = new BMap.Point(121.624667,31.1010096);var marker = new BMap.Marker(point); // 创建标注map.addOverlay(marker); // 将标注添加到地图中marker.setAnimation(BMAP_ANIMATION_BOUNCE);map.centerAndZoom(po.

2020-06-16 17:44:28

css after/before content 计数器

此为倒序,正序去掉counter-increment的-1即可

2020-06-16 17:43:54

好看的css阴影效果

border: none;box-shadow: 0 12px 5px -10px rgba(0,0,0,0.1), 0 0 4px 0 rgba(0,0,0,0.1);-webkit-box-shadow: 0 12px 5px -10px rgba(0,0,0,0.1), 0 0 4px 0 rgba(0,0,0,0.1);border-radius: 5px;

2020-06-16 17:42:39

查看更多

勋章 我的勋章
  • 签到新秀
    签到新秀
    累计签到获取,不积跬步,无以至千里,继续坚持!
  • 持之以恒
    持之以恒
    授予每个自然月内发布4篇或4篇以上原创或翻译IT博文的用户。不积跬步无以至千里,不积小流无以成江海,程序人生的精彩需要坚持不懈地积累!
  • 勤写标兵Lv1
    勤写标兵Lv1
    授予每个自然周发布1篇到3篇原创IT博文的用户。本勋章将于次周周三上午根据用户上周的博文发布情况由系统自动颁发。
  • 原力新人
    原力新人
    在《原力计划【第二季】》打卡挑战活动中,成功参与本活动并发布一篇原创文章的博主,即可获得此勋章。